Output e3cce680acd45fd2a78ba55d00eeb4963cd7635facac98d9b7341e05555acafa:1

value
677953
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b0887d09814b5c01db5bda02c7ef3954522edfa57d963e88c1f91df64686250b
address
bc1pkzy86zvpfdwqrk6mmgpv0mee23fzaha90ktrazxplywlv35xy59svg40ev
transaction
e3cce680acd45fd2a78ba55d00eeb4963cd7635facac98d9b7341e05555acafa
spent
true